Do Pigeons Lay Eggs?

Yes, pigeons do lay eggs. Pigeons are exciting creatures, and Many of us are curious about their nesting habits. Pigeons usually lay two eggs at a time, and the two mom and dad consider turns incubating them. The eggs usually hatch following about eighteen times.

Pigeon eggs are white and relatively small, 3 centimeters lengthy. The female lays the eggs in the nest normally fabricated from sticks and twigs. Both mom and dad support to incubate the eggs by retaining them heat with their system heat.

Immediately after eighteen times, the chicks hatch and are quickly equipped to get started on walking and seeking food items by themselves. Pigeons are monogamous. Pigeons usually increase 3 broods every year, but occasionally, they are going to have 4 broods if ailments are favorable.
